Hyatt Regency Mainz

Malakoff-Terrasse 1 Mainz 55116 Germany
Property Type: Hotel
  • Lodging offering guest rooms, a 24-hour front desk and a variety of services and amenities.
Business-Oriented Hotel in contemporary 6-story building located at Stresemannufer on banks of the Rhine, next to Fort Malakoff.
